Computer Education Techniques instructor training program is the unifying element of the services delivered under the SYS-ED brand name. Only the "crème de la crème" are eligible to participate in the program. Source vendor certifications are an integral to the program, but not to the exclusion of a well-rounded multi-disciplinary approach to analyzing, explaining, and teaching information technology subject matter.  Each system consultant is required to generate inputs, contribute independent research, and produce outputs which meet the standards of the New York State Department of Education. The training program ensures that the system consultant is a qualified teacher with the experience to effectively utilize technology for presenting IT subject matter. The training program is a foundation of the quality control and professionalism, which is the hallmark of the SYS-ED service.

Technology partners who satisfy these requirements and meet the standards are selected  to teach SYS-ED courses.
